Basal Nuclei
Groups of neurons located deep within the cerebral hemispheres, involved in the control of movement.
Cerebellum
A part of the brain at the back of the skull in vertebrates, crucial for coordination, precision, and accurate timing of movements.
Cerebrum
The largest part of the brain, responsible for voluntary actions, sensory perception, thought, reasoning, and memory.
Diencephalon
A division of the brain located between the cerebral hemispheres and brainstem, encompassing structures such as the thalamus and hypothalamus.
